Teaching Methods

The assessment of this course will be based on the activities developed through an experiential training program in an outdoor environment. This will be complemented by individual assessment on the topics of the syllabus and the activities performed through the elaboration of an individual essay. The global assessment will take into account the following parameters:

• Group Performance - 50%

• Evaluation of monitors: increase or reduction of up to three points

• Essay - 50%

Learning Outcomes

The course unit is part of the area of soft skills that is becoming more popular in recent times. The proposed syllabus associated

with the methodology adopted aims to promote a better self-knowledge of the participants, better awareness of individual emotions and their role in the decision making, as well as its role in team activities. The syllabus is based on the assumption that experiential education promotes a greater involvement of the participants with the topics being discussed. As a final result, participants must develop a new vision of teamwork and realize that it gives members a sense of control over their lives; protects from the power and the hierarchy; Improves individual identification with the overall objectives of the organization; promotes the collective learning; improves self-esteem and the levels of self-realization; disseminates the values and behaviors that the leader expects from the participants; increases the overall performance of the organization.

Syllabus

I. Emotional Intelligence contributions to manage people and teams

II. The pursuit of self-knowledge

III. The importance of team work (team versus group)

IV. Building the team

V. The role of leadership

VI. Winning Teams
